Using Google Docs in the Classroom - 0 views

  • Fred Delventhal
     
    We've heard many ingenious ways that teachers have used Google Docs in the classroom. Here are just a few:

    * Promote group collaboration and creativity by having your students record their group projects together in a single doc.
    * Keep track of grades, attendance, or any other data you can think of using an easily accessible, always available spreadsheet.
    * Facilitate writing as a process by encouraging students to write in a document shared with you. You can check up on their work at any time, provide insight and help using the comments feature, and understand better each students strengths.
    * Create quizzes and tests using spreadsheets forms, your students' timestamped answers will arrive neatly ordered in a spreadsheet.
    * Encourage collaborative presentation skills by asking your students to work together on a shared presentation, then present it to the class.
    * Collaborate on a document with fellow teachers to help you all track the status and success of students you share.
    * Maintain, update and share lesson plans over time in a single document.
    * Track and organize cumulative project data in a single spreadsheet, accessible to any collaborator at any time.
